Title: Materials Data on Rb4Pb9 by Materials Project

Rb4Pb9 is Magnesium tetraboride-like structured and crystallizes in the monoclinic P2_1/m space group. The structure is three-dimensional. there are five inequivalent Rb sites. In the first Rb site, Rb is bonded in a 7-coordinate geometry to seven Pb atoms. There are a spread of Rb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.82–3.93 Å. In the second Rb site, Rb is bonded in a 8-coordinate geometry to eight Pb atoms. There are a spread of Rb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.87–4.29 Å. In the third Rb site, Rb is bonded in a 8-coordinate geometry to eight Pb atoms. There are a spread of Rb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.84–4.14 Å. In the fourth Rb site, Rb is bonded in a 7-coordinate geometry to seven Pb atoms. There are a spread of Rb–Pb bond distances ranging from 4.01–4.04 Å. In the fifth Rb site, Rb is bonded in a 7-coordinate geometry to eight Pb atoms. There are a spread of Rb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.81–4.35 Å. There are twelve inequivalent Pb sites. In the first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 8-coordinate geometry to four Rb and four Pb atoms. There are a spread of Pb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.14–3.27 Å. In the second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 1-coordinate geometry to three Rb and five Pb atoms. There are a spread of Pb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.13–3.50 Å. In the third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 1-coordinate geometry to three Rb and five Pb atoms. There are a spread of Pb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.15–3.45 Å. In the fourth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 8-coordinate geometry to four Rb and four Pb atoms. There are a spread of Pb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.16–3.25 Å. In the fifth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 6-coordinate geometry to three Rb and five Pb atoms. There are one shorter (3.14 Å) and two longer (3.53 Å) Pb–Pb bond lengths. In the sixth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 2-coordinate geometry to four Rb and four Pb atoms. There are a spread of Pb–Pb bond distances ranging from 3.16–3.20 Å. In the seventh Pb site, Pb is bonded in a distorted body-centered cubic geometry to four Rb and four Pb atoms. In the eighth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 9-coordinate geometry to four Rb and five Pb atoms. Both Pb–Pb bond lengths are 3.25 Å. In the ninth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 7-coordinate geometry to three Rb and four Pb atoms. In the tenth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 1-coordinate geometry to five Rb and four Pb atoms. Both Pb–Pb bond lengths are 3.16 Å. In the eleventh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 7-coordinate geometry to three Rb and four Pb atoms. There are one shorter (3.22 Å) and one longer (3.23 Å) Pb–Pb bond lengths. In the twelfth Pb site, Pb is bonded in a 1-coordinate geometry to two Rb and five Pb atoms.
